Kearney
, city (1990 pop. 24,396), S central Nebr., on
the Platte R; Buffalo co.; 40°42'N 99°04'W. It is
a commercial, industrial, and transportation center in an agr. area.
Univ. of Nebr. at Kearney and Kearney State Col. located here. Mfg.
(plastic prods., machinery, fabricated metal prods., printing and
publishing, transportation equip., apparel). Fort Kearny State
Historical Park to S (named for Gen. Stephen W. Kearny), est. 1848 to
protect the Oregon Trail, was abandoned in 1871. Kearney Co. State
Recreation Area to SE. Co. Fairgrounds, Municipal Airport, Union
Pacific State Wayside Area to W. Inc. 1873.
